Metformin: Evidence for a Beneficial
Effect in Ovulation Induction
Small RCTs in POCS patient undergoing hMG ovulation induction
Decreased OHSS, multiple pregnancy, hMG utilization• Yarali Hum Reprod 17(2) 2002
• Tadesmir Arch Gynecol Obstet 269, 2004
Increases mono-ovulatory follicle development• Palomba Hum Reprod 20(10), 2005
Decreased miscarriage rate
Two non-randomized studies demonstrate >50% decrease in first trimester miscarriage in PCO patients
• Jakubowitz JCEM 87(2), 2002
• Glueck, Fertil Steril 75, 2001

Meta analysis of 9 RCTs
Clinical pregnancy rate higher (OR 1.52, 1.07 to 2.15)
70 % reduction in OHSS (OR 0.29, 0.18 to 0.49)• Tso, Cochrane Database Syst Rev 2014
• Tso Fertil Steril, Sept 2015
Metformin in PCOS/IVF
![Page 13: Stimulating PCOS Patients Undergoing IVF - nrmvt.comEF%80%A2PCOS-ASRM-2016-Casson.pdfStimulating PCOS Patients Undergoing IVF Peter Casson MD Reproductive Endocrinology and Infertility](https://reader031.vdocuments.us/reader031/viewer/2022022003/5aa53d757f8b9a1d728cd9dc/html5/thumbnails/13.jpg)
Metformin in POCS/IVF
WHO Guidelines:
“Metfomin useful to reduce the risk of OHSS”• Balen, Hum Reprod Update August 2016
BFS Guidelines:
“has a positive effect in women with PCOS undergoing IVF”
• Nardo, Hum Fertil 18(1) 2015
SOGC Guideline:
“The addition of metformin should be considered in patients with PCOS undergoing IVF because it may reduce the incidence of OHSS”
• SOGC guideline 315, November 2014

ICSI in PCO/IVF
Fertilization rate reported lower in patients with PCOS at IVF
Sibling oocyte study (PCO, normal sperm)
1089 oocytes from 60 cycles randomized to ICSI or standard IVF
Higher fertilization rate (72% vs. 45%), lower total fertilization failure (0% vs. 15%)
• Hwang, Hum Reprod 20(5), 2005
No Randomized controlled trials

Is ISCI Overused? SART CDC Data
ICSI/Unexplained infertility (n = 317 996)
Lower implantation (23.0% vs 25.2%, RR, 0.93; 95%, 0.91-0.95)
Lower live birth (36.5% vs 39.2%, RR, 0.95; 95% CI, 0.93-0.97)
Boulet JAMA, 313(3), 2015

IVM at IVF
Retrieval of immature (GV) oocyte-cumulus complexes from follicles <13 mm with or without a short course of rFSH or hCG priming
In vitro culture with added hCG, FSH for up to 3 days
Used in patients at risk for OHSS and fertility preservation
Faster, less expensive, works best in PCOS patients
No OHSS
Lower pregnancy rates than standard IVF

IVM in PCOS: Conclusions
Requires special expertise
Effective in reducing OHSS but pregnancy rates are lower
Largely superseded by other techniques to avoid OHSS
Variations of IVM may still be useful to maximize embryo yield from immature oocytes obtained at a PCO/IVF retrieval

Coasting
First described by Sher 199
Withholding gonadotropins/hCGtrigger until E2 falls below a threshold level (3,000-5000 pg/ml)
Larger follicles have less FSH requirement, leads to atresia of smaller follicles, less VEGF production
Need to push stimulation until follicles >12-15 mm
![Page 25: Stimulating PCOS Patients Undergoing IVF - nrmvt.comEF%80%A2PCOS-ASRM-2016-Casson.pdfStimulating PCOS Patients Undergoing IVF Peter Casson MD Reproductive Endocrinology and Infertility](https://reader031.vdocuments.us/reader031/viewer/2022022003/5aa53d757f8b9a1d728cd9dc/html5/thumbnails/25.jpg)
Coasting: Results
Oocyte numbers, fertilization, embryo
development and pregnancy rates not
adversely affected
OHSS rate reduced to 2.5%• Delvigne A, Hum Reprod 16:2491, 2001
Coasting has adverse effect if > 3 days• Mansour R Hum Reprod 20, 2005

Cabergoline For OHSS
Dopamine agonists decrease VEGF
production of granulosa cells in Vitro • Ferrero Repro Bio endocr 2015
60-70% reduction in mild and moderate
OHSS• Cochrane 2012 (2 RCTs)
Meta analysis of 7 studies, 858 women:
60% reduction in moderate and severe
OHSS• Leitao Fert Steril 2014
No reduction of pregnancy rate in either analysis
![Page 28: Stimulating PCOS Patients Undergoing IVF - nrmvt.comEF%80%A2PCOS-ASRM-2016-Casson.pdfStimulating PCOS Patients Undergoing IVF Peter Casson MD Reproductive Endocrinology and Infertility](https://reader031.vdocuments.us/reader031/viewer/2022022003/5aa53d757f8b9a1d728cd9dc/html5/thumbnails/28.jpg)
Cabergoline to Prevent OHSS:
0.25 to 0.5 mg daily for 8 days to 3 weeks
Starting at hCG trigger or oocyte retrieval
Often given in conjunction with albumin at retrieval
Done with freeze all or through the first week of
pregnancy

Antagonist Protocols For OHSS
Prevention
Meta analysis of 29 RCTs
Antagonist cycles reduce the risk of OHSS (OR 0.43, 0.33-
0.57)
No difference in pregnancy and live birth• Al-Inany HG Cochrane Database Syst Review 111(5) 2011
Allows for the use of an agonist trigger
![Page 30: Stimulating PCOS Patients Undergoing IVF - nrmvt.comEF%80%A2PCOS-ASRM-2016-Casson.pdfStimulating PCOS Patients Undergoing IVF Peter Casson MD Reproductive Endocrinology and Infertility](https://reader031.vdocuments.us/reader031/viewer/2022022003/5aa53d757f8b9a1d728cd9dc/html5/thumbnails/30.jpg)
Agonist trigger
Pulse of agonist displaces antagonist off GnRH receptors, stimulates endogenous surge of LH/FSH
3-5 mg leuprolide or 0.2 to 0.5mg leuprelin/triptorlin/buserelin 36-40 and again 24 -26 hours before retrieval
Meta analysis of 17 RCTs:
Reduction of OHSS (OR 0.15, 0.05-0.47)
Reduction in live birth rate (OR 0.47, 0.31-0.70)
Higher miscarriage rate (OR 1.74, 1.1-2.75)
No change in pregnancy rate in donor-recipient cyclesYouseff M, Cochrane database syst rev Oct 2014
![Page 31: Stimulating PCOS Patients Undergoing IVF - nrmvt.comEF%80%A2PCOS-ASRM-2016-Casson.pdfStimulating PCOS Patients Undergoing IVF Peter Casson MD Reproductive Endocrinology and Infertility](https://reader031.vdocuments.us/reader031/viewer/2022022003/5aa53d757f8b9a1d728cd9dc/html5/thumbnails/31.jpg)
Agonist Trigger Problems
Lower pregnancy rates in fresh autologous cycles
Freeze all
Intensive luteal supplementation
E, P, supplemental hCG at retrieval or in luteal phase
2% failure rate- no eggs!
Risk factors: prolonged OCP use, hypothalamic anovulation
Check LH, progesterone day after trigger
retrigger if LH <15, reassuring if LH >50
hCG co-trigger (1000-5000 iu hCG)

Freeze all For OHSS Prevention
Demonstrated in 1999 RCT that elective freeze all in at-
risk patients reduced OHSS risk, no difference in
pregnancy rates• Ferraretti, Hum Rep 1999
Problems:
FET rates typically not as high as fresh ETs
Added cost (financial and emotional)
More time commitment
Can still see severe OHSS with no embryo transfer (ie donor
cycles)
![Page 33: Stimulating PCOS Patients Undergoing IVF - nrmvt.comEF%80%A2PCOS-ASRM-2016-Casson.pdfStimulating PCOS Patients Undergoing IVF Peter Casson MD Reproductive Endocrinology and Infertility](https://reader031.vdocuments.us/reader031/viewer/2022022003/5aa53d757f8b9a1d728cd9dc/html5/thumbnails/33.jpg)
Freeze All Vs. Fresh ET in PCOS IVF
Chen et al, NEJM 375(6), 2016
RCT of 1508 PCO patients undergoing IVF (+/- ICSI)
Agonist Stimulation, hCG trigger (4000-8000 IU)
IM Progesterone 80 mg/day for luteal support
Fresh or Frozen ET of 1or 2 day three embryos
Primary outcome live birth
Secondary outcomes:
Clinical pregnancy
Pregnancy loss
OHSS
Intent to treat analysis

Agonist trigger/Freeze all in PCO
Pros:
Avoid hyperstimulation
Get more eggs
Accrue benefits of FET:
Reduced prematurity, birth defects
Cons:
Can only do if your FET as good as your fresh rate
Additional cost, time, expense
More meds
![Page 36: Stimulating PCOS Patients Undergoing IVF - nrmvt.comEF%80%A2PCOS-ASRM-2016-Casson.pdfStimulating PCOS Patients Undergoing IVF Peter Casson MD Reproductive Endocrinology and Infertility](https://reader031.vdocuments.us/reader031/viewer/2022022003/5aa53d757f8b9a1d728cd9dc/html5/thumbnails/36.jpg)
Optimizing PCOS/IVF Stimulations Metformin reduces OHSS (may improve preg rate)
ICSI not needed (individualize)
Changing gonadotropin, decreasing hCG trigger
has no clear benefit
IVM may help, but requires special expertise
Coasting reduces but does not eliminate OHSS
Cabergoline likely reduces OHSS 60%
antagonist cycles reduce OHSS 50 %
Agonist triggers reduce OHSS 80%
Freeze-all cycles reduce but does not preclude
OHSS
Agonist trigger/freeze all cycles most effective
modality
